Melanie Oudin in second round of 2010 U.S. Open

The last event of the annual Grand Slam series started today in New York City. And last year, Melanie Oudin, all of a sudden and completely unexpectedly, played in the quarterfinals, as the youngest female player since Serena Williams in 1999. The expectations are high and today she had to overcome the first hurdle in her opening match at the 2010 U.S. Open against qualifier Olga Savchuck of Ukraine. Oudin won relatively easily in two straight sets 6-3 and 6-0. Melanie Oudin is currently ranked 43 in the world and she played solid tennis all throughout the match, compiling 20-3 winners and visibly pumped-up. Kim Clijsters takes first hurdle at 2010 U.S. Open

She is the defending champion and the expectations are high. It is not always an easy situation for the highly favored player to make it through the first rounds, as everybody expects straight and easy wins. Clijsters played well in her opening match against Hungary’s Greta Arn who is currently ranked 104th. But the Belgian had to overcome a little bit of a lapse in the second set of her 2010 U.S. Open first round match. She took the first one easily with a 6-0 but then quickly fell behind 4-0 in the second set. Robin Soderling and his 2010 U.S. Open first round struggle

Robin Soderling made it into the second round of the 2010 U.S. Open. Barely! His opponent Austrian Andreas Haider-Maurer, the 214th in the world, almost caused a major upset. Soderling started the Open as 5-seeded and today he could not really count on one of his biggest weapons, his strong serve. He committed a total of 13 double faults. His opponent hit 34 aces, Soderling only 9. As the match started, everything went according to plan for the Swede who took the first two sets and had even match points in the third. Guns N Roses Slammed For Poor Attitude

According to Newsbeat, iconic rock band Guns N’ Roses have been slammed by festival organizers after turning up late for both the Reading and Leeds music festivals. Also, lead singer Axel Rose was criticised for hurling expletives at the organisers of the festivals after they had to stop the band’s performances after they went over their allotted time slots. Lost Prophet guitarist Mike Lewis commented on the incident by saying… “It was so predictable that he was going to be late that nobody bothered questioning why. It’s so predictable, it’s boring. Reynolds and Cooper to Star in Turner Action Comedy

Ryan Reynolds and Bradley Cooper look like they will be teaming up to star alongside one another in an as yet untitled original comedy from the guy who brought us the George Clooney flick Up In The Air. According to Risky Business the comedy… “Follows two friends, who are also San Francisco cops, whose fathers were once partners on the police force. The older generation is forced out of retirement to help their sons crack a case, with typically antagonistic results.” Sounds like it could be fun.
